"Wake Up"
|
Released: August 2016
Engine: Unreal Engine 4 Genre: Virtual Reality Puzzle-Platformer Role: Product Owner, Gameplay- & Level-Designer As a Gameplay- and Level-Designer on this project I designed many of the puzzles in this game before implementing them in-engine. I was hands-on in most of the areas of this project, from the intro-scene to helping out with audio-implementation, you name it. Because of this I am especially humbled by the huge success of this project on Steam. In addition, I was named Product Owner for this project, which made me partly responsible for things like Time- and Task-Management as well as deadline coordination for our small team. |
"What the Hen!"
|
Released: June 2016
Engine: Unity Genre: 2D Mobile Tug of War Role: External Level- & Mission-Designer During my run on this project I was responsible for helping out with Gameplay- and Story-Designs, developing and implementing Mission-Scripts in-engine, as well as Minion- and Mission-Balancing. For this task, our amazing programmers provided me with an in-engine tool that allowed me to time monster spawns and abilities. Being part of this international team of industry veterans was an incredible experience. |
